Honda of Watertown responded

Mr. France, I apologize that you have had so many issues with the vehicle you purchased from us in our service department. I have collected the previous repair orders on your vehicle and on your original replacement of your belt. It was recommended that the tensioner on your vehicle be upgraded to match the modifications done to your vehicle elsewhere. It was also mentioned that the person who modified your vehicle should have changed the tensioner when the work was done. Subsequently that is what caused your belt to shred as you mentioned. Within less than 300 miles you returned because the belt was making a squealing noise. The belt was changed again at no charge to you due to the fact we had just changed the belt. It was also noted again that the tensioner should be changed because of the aftermarket parts. As a Honda dealership we can not install non Honda modified parts. When you returned again after 1000 miles we also noted on your repair order that the issue with your belt would continue if the tensioner was not changed to match the other modifications to your vehicle. As noted on all your repair orders this issue would continue until the aftermarket parts were changed to match your modifications. After speaking with the service manager we wanted to offer you some credit in service because you were a good customer. I'm sorry you are not happy with the service department but they had informed you from the beginning that the modifications had to be complete. Otherwise you would continue to have issues and those were modifications we could not complete at the dealership. Sincerely, Richard Bierce
